Basic information Supplier

2-[(4-benzylpiperazin-1-yl)carbonyl]-5-(4-chlorophenyl)-7-(trifluoromethyl)-4,5,6,7-tetrahydropyrazolo[1,5-a]pyrimidine

Basic information Supplier
378754-58-6 Basic informationMore

Browse by Nationality 378754-58-6 Suppliers >Global suppliers

Please select the suppliers
Recommend You Select Member Companies